OLIVER, Judge.

Floyd Palmer, Jr., the plaintiff in error and defendant below, was convicted of first degree murder in the Criminal Court of Hamilton County and was sentenced to imprisonment in the State Penitentiary for twenty years and one day. His motion for a new trial being overruled, he prayed and was granted and has perfected an appeal in the nature of a writ of error to this Court...
